IJR News — today's news from every sideUber cuts 3,300 jobs to fund AI and self-driving push — Sep 3, 2026Uber announced a 10% global workforce reduction, roughly 3,300 to 3,400 jobs, aimed at simplifying the organization, cutting management layers, and freeing resources for drivers, couriers, merchants, and autonomous driving initiatives. The company will consolidate teams around major hubs in SF and NY and require most employees to work in-office, signaling a broader push into AI and self-driving technology amid industry competition.

Drowning prevention gains momentum as WHO launches PROTECT — Jul 23, 2026The World Health Organization unveiled PROTECT, a seven‑pillar technical package to prevent drowning, focusing on safer water infrastructure, rescue and resuscitation, occupational safety, stronger water transport standards, swimming and water safety education, child protection, and flood and emergency preparedness, with Ghana highlighted as the launch site ahead of World Drowning Prevention Day. The plan targets roughly 300,000 drowning deaths annually—predominantly in low‑ and middle‑income countries—and follows a global strategy to cut deaths by a substantial margin by 2035 amid rising climate-related risks, calling for cross‑sector action by governments and partners.
